Golden Rule #1: No employer will be interested in you if he/she can't be convinced that you can make a real contribution to bottom line or that you can make the employer's job easier. If you fail to communicate that in your interviews, resume and written or spoken messages . . . you're OUT!

The burden is on you to prove you can make a difference. That means you have to research what the organization's goals are and specifically what the hiring decision-maker is looking for. And then be prepared to present specific contributions.

If you think that somehow an employer will figure out what you can do by reading between the lines of your resume or second-guessing your interview presentation . . . well, they don't have the time or interest to do that. Besides, if you can't show how you bring value, there's someone else right behind you who can.

Golden Rule #2: You are in charge of your job search success . . . and only you! If you leave your job search up to chance by using passive, uninvolved strategies you just LOST!

For example, hoping that posting your resume to a half dozen job search website like Monster or HotJobs will get you the job you deserve is worse than wishful thinking. It's delusion! The same applies to answering endless ads or expecting recruiters or agencies to handle everything for you.

Golden Rule # 3: The most valuable asset you have that can guarantee you a speedy and lucrative job search are your CONTACTS. These are people you already know starting with relatives, friends, neighbors, religious leaders, business associates and customers, people you buy things from (like insurance, financial services, contractors, etc.). However, you can't turn them off by asking them to find you a job. You need to have a carefully-crafted script that will turn them into career partners.

If you are a life science, medical or computer graduate with a dream of being a part of research and development of path breaking science projects and making medicinal breakthroughs, Clinical Research is field for you. Clinical Research is the systematic scientific study of testing a new drug, medical device, or other types of therapeutic solutions on human subjects to verify its efficacy, safety and benefits as well as record any adverse effects it might have on patients.
